It’s a Home Away from Home
When you are traveling, one of your main priorities is comfort and one advantage of owning an RV is that it is literally a home away from home. You can stock it with whatever you want, and sleep in a bed that is comfortable and familiar. Travel Easily
Owning an RV gives you the potential to travel when and where you want. Imagine waking up one morning, deciding you want to take a quick trip for a scenic drive in Arizona, or visit the fall colors of America’s east coast on a whim. With an RV that option is there for you. You can hit the open road and just drive, or you might have a specific location in mind. Either way, it’s simple to do. You will be saving on the cost of flights or other transportation, too.
Save Money
One of the biggest costs of a vacation is accommodation. If you have an RV, you won’t have to pay these costs. You also save on having to eat out each night as you can simply cook in your RV. This is especially convenient if you have a large family. Expenditure when you are on vacation can very quickly add up, and it can lead you to make the decision not to take a vacation at all because it’s too expensive. When you own an RV, these costs are dramatically reduced and you can spend your vacation without having to watch the pennies.
Escape the Cold
If you’ve ever woken up one morning, looked out of the window and saw heavy snow falling, you’ve also probably wished you were somewhere much warmer. If there was an RV on your driveway, you could simply get your things together and head towards a nicer climate. This is a freedom afforded to few, and it is something that you should seriously consider as an enormous benefit to owning an RV. The weather has a huge effect on our mental health, and being able to escape it when it’s bad could be life changing.
